Aliya Rahman's Arrest: A State of Union Disruption

What Happened at the State of the Union?

Aliya Rahman, a disabled activist and guest of Representative Ilhan Omar at the recent State of the Union address, faced a harrowing ordeal after she was forcibly removed for quietly standing during the address. The Capitol Police allegedly committed a severe overreach by dragging her from the gallery, putting her injuries at risk and igniting outrage amongst civil liberties advocates.

Background on Aliya Rahman

Rahman, diagnosed with autism and a traumatic brain injury, has already fought against injustice this year. Earlier, she captured national attention when federal immigration agents detained her while on her way to a medical appointment in Minneapolis. Following her release without charges, Rahman testified on the aggressive tactics used by federal immigration agents, an experience that highlights the systemic issues present in our enforcement landscape.

The Arrest

On the night of the State of the Union, Rahman reported being pulled out of her seat by police officers despite other members in the gallery also standing. As she asserted her rights to protest silently, the police stated she was disrupting Congress—an assertion Rahman and her attorney vehemently contest. She stated,

"I was told that I couldn't stand up... other people are also standing up. So that was a pretty confusing situation.”

Legal Implications

Rahman was charged with unlawful conduct, a move described by her attorney, Jessica Gingold, as unprecedented. Gingold noted that the act of simply standing up should not warrant criminal charges, advocating for the immediate dismissal of the charges against Rahman. Her narrative, coupled with the heavy-handed police response, poses significant questions about the state of protests in America today.

Public Reaction

Public figures and advocates alike have called for accountability. Representative Ilhan Omar condemned the incident, demanding an inquiry into the arrest, stating,

"The heavy-handed response to a peaceful guest sends a chilling message about the state of our democracy."
